
“All prison employees are under constant monitoring and undergo specialized training in the field.” This was the response of the Deputy Director General of Prisons, Femi Sufaj, to the accusations made earlier by journalist Artan Hoxha, regarding the introduction of escorts into prisons.
Asked during a conversation on "Off the Record" on A2 CNN, Sufaj added that the journalist should actually be prosecuted for the statements made, as according to him, it is a matter of defamation.
"I know that he is actually under investigation. But, for what he said, he should be prosecuted. Because it is a low slander, which you cannot do to anyone, because those who work there are people, they have dignity, they have families," said Sufaj.
At a time when many questions have been raised about what is happening within the walls of our prisons, from which murders are ordered and from where corruption and external influence seem to undermine every rule, the Deputy Director General of Prisons emphasizes that the system in prison institutions is actually improving.
"....Especially in terms of employee recruitment. Employees are first selected with integrity, after being selected they undergo specialized training for the field. They are under constant monitoring...There are standard rules that you are monitored everywhere with cameras ," he added.
We recall that journalist Artan Hoxha stated a few days ago that there are several different ways that some people, including well-known showbiz figures, use to get into prison.
According to him, there are girls who enter prison institutions as psychologists or trainers and actually act as escorts.
